What companies run services between New York, NY, USA and National Cryptologic Museum, MD, USA?

Amtrak Acela operates a train from Ny Moynihan Train Hall At Penn Station to Baltimore Penn Station hourly. Tickets cost $40–700 and the journey takes 2h 22m. Amtrak also services this route hourly. Alternatively, Flixbus USA operates a bus from New York Midtown to Baltimore Downtown Bus Station every 2 hours. Tickets cost $30–55 and the journey takes 3h 20m.
